Aphasia

Aphasia is a loss of the ability to understand language and/or use language for speaking or writing.  It can be caused by stroke, traumatic brain injury or other damage to the brain.

Suncoast Aphasia Support Group

The support group includes people with aphasia and their spouses, families and friends.  It is as much for the person with aphasia as it is for their caregiver.
